Passenger Attempts to Enter Cockpit on Delta Flight: Houston Police Respond

This recent incident highlights ongoing concerns over attempted cockpit breaches in recent years.

WASHINGTON — On Wednesday morning, Houston police apprehended an individual who allegedly attempted to enter the cockpit of a Delta Airlines flight.

The Houston Police Department reported receiving a call at 5:38 a.m. regarding a passenger trying to force their way into the aircraft’s cockpit.

The plane was approaching Gate 32 at William P. Hobby Airport when the situation unfolded.

The flight was reportedly en route from Houston’s Hobby Airport to Atlanta.

No injuries were reported, and it’s unclear what circumstances led to the attempted cockpit breach. 

Commercial aircraft cockpits are the most secure areas onboard the aircraft, with advancements in safety technology made in the quarter-century since the Sept. 11, 2001 terrorist attacks. In those attacks, hijackers breached the cockpits of four planes and rammed significant U.S. infrastructure, bringing down the Twin Towers in New York and damaging the Pentagon in Washington, D.C. 

The attacks forced a reckoning for airline safety, and prompted a number of widespread crackdowns on potentially dangerous activity from airline passengers. The TSA was created to screen passengers, cockpits were hardened and new locking procedures were developed for them. 

This incident is the latest in the past half-decade in which there have been fears of a cockpit breach. In October 2023, an off-duty pilot was accused of trying to shut down the engines of a Horizon Air jet while mid-flight. And in Oct. 2025, the pilots of a SkyWest flight mistakenly thought somebody was trying to breach the cockpit and forced an emergency landing.
